Re: YouTube TV -- Live TV streaming service

https://awfulannouncing.com/online-o...-networks.html

This clearly explains the new deal.

Basically if you live in Los Angeles or New York and even Chicago you got hosed.

YouTube TV will not carry FOX Sports West, Prime Ticket, YES Network as mentioned and the new Cubs network Marquee.

I don't understand this deal.
